Crime Scene - Advanced Basics
ADVANCED BASICS is a great alternative for those who don't require extensive evidence training or can't schedule a five day class. Students still receive three days of Advanced evidence training. (Days 2, 3, & 4 of the Crucial Minutes)

ADVANCED BASICS is a hands-on class equally valuable for the first response officer, investigator, and evidence technician and includes information on the following: when to request evidence specialists, evidence lost before the barrier tape goes up, evidence found on the arrested suspect, and how to recognize evidence in general. The first day is spent in a detailed study of basic and advanced techniques of fingerprint science (latent and inked). Day two is a study of bloodspatter basics. This segment includes the importance of velocity considerations in interpreting the bloodspatter, formulas for determining angle of impact, discussion of cast off blood and back spatter, and study of transfer patterns. The day concludes with a practical exercise and demonstratoin of blood spatter to determine angle, convergence, and origin. Day three includes discussion and practicals on gunshot residue/trace metal detection and footwear/tiretrack documentation and casting. Trace metal topics include shortwave UV light exam, pattern observation, and documentation and casting. Trace metal topics include shortwave UV light exam, pattern observation, and documentation. Gunshot residue topics cover proper swabbing techniques & common reasons for conflicting and inconclusive results. Footwear/tiretrack topics include protecting the impression, photography techniques, dental stone casting, dustprint lifting, and sketching.
